Is there any way to properly integrate Subversion control into VS2008? I’m currently using the TortoiseSVN shell extensions, but I keep forgetting to check in new files and it’s easy to get in a confused mess.
On another project I use VS2008 with SourceSafe, and it’s really nice having most things automated or controlled simply by using VS in its normal way.
I use AnkhSVN myself and so far it has been great, it is free and you can download it here: http://ankhsvn.open.collab.net/